PowerPort isp M.R.I. Implantable Port with Attachable 8F Polyurethane Open-Ended Single-Lumen Venous Catheter

On 2019-12-04 the FDA classified a Class II recall of PowerPort isp M.R.I. Implantable Port with Attachable 8F Polyurethane Open-Ended Single-Lumen Venous Catheter by Bard Peripheral Vascular, citing complaints received that products packaged with the incorrect introducer sheath size.
